Detectives have charged a man who allegedly stole a car with a sleeping toddler inside in Victoria's north last week.

It is alleged that the man stole the vehicle from a supermarket car park on Maude Street in Shepparton just before 2pm on November 14.

When the man realised a 15-month-old boy was in the car, he removed the child and left him in a box in the car park, police said.

The female car owner returned and found the unharmed toddler.

The man allegedly fled in the Volkswagen, which was found in Mooroopna the next day.

A 32-year-old was arrested in central Shepparton yesterday afternoon.

The Mooroopna man was later charged with motor vehicle theft, reckless conduct, endangering serious injury and committing an indictable offence while on bail.
